ACE · American Council on Education
ACE Credit
ACE evaluates non-traditional learning — corporate training, workforce programs, credit-by-exam — and recommends equivalent college credit. CLEP® exams themselves are ACE-reviewed. Colleges that are ACE-aligned often accept ACE coursework in addition to CLEP®.
Source: acenet.edu
NCCRS · NCSC is a Member
NCCRS Credit
The National College Credit Recommendation Service, administered by the University of the State of New York, reviews non-collegiate coursework and assigns college-equivalent credit. NCSC is a listed NCCRS member, meaning NCCRS-recommended self-paced courses may count toward degree requirements.
Source: nationalccrs.org

About North Central State College

NCSC
in brief.

North Central State College is a public community college in Mansfield, Ohio. It serves students in north central Ohio and operates as part of the Ohio community college system. The college is located on a campus in Mansfield and also offers classes and services for students in the surrounding region.

The college offers associate degrees, certificates, and workforce-oriented programs designed for transfer and career preparation. Its academic offerings include general education and technical fields, with pathways that can support students who plan to continue to a four-year institution. Community colleges like North Central State College are often focused on affordability, access, and flexible scheduling.

For CLEP and transfer-credit purposes, North Central State College is a public college that students may use as a starting point for earning transferable coursework. Whether CLEP credit is accepted depends on the college's current policies and the specific exam, score, and degree program. Students should confirm transferability before testing or enrolling, especially if they plan to move credits to another institution.

Credit evaluation at North Central State College is handled through the college's academic and registrar processes, which determine how prior learning, transfer coursework, and exam-based credit apply to a student's program. As with most colleges, official transcripts and supporting documentation are typically required for evaluation. Students should consult the registrar or academic advising office for the most current rules on credit posting, residency requirements, and degree applicability.

FAQ

Questions, answered.

How many CLEP® exams does North Central State College accept?
North Central State College accepts 22 CLEP® exams for college credit across Business, Composition and Literature, History and Social Sciences, Science and Mathematics, and World Languages.
What minimum CLEP® score does NCSC require?
NCSC requires minimum CLEP® scores in the range of 47 – 68 depending on the exam. The standard ACE-recommended passing score for CLEP® is 50.
How do I send my CLEP® score to North Central State College?
Enter NCSC's institution code 7693 when registering for your CLEP® exam. Scores transmit automatically to the Registrar.
How many CLEP® credits can I apply toward my NCSC degree?
Most undergraduate programs cap credit-by-exam at approximately 30 semester hours. Confirm program-specific caps with the Registrar.
Does NCSC accept DSST exams?
DSST acceptance at NCSC is not confirmed in our dataset. Contact the Registrar for current policy.
Is NCSC an NCCRS member institution?
Yes. NCSC is listed as an NCCRS member institution on nationalccrs.org.
How long does it take to earn CLEP® credit at NCSC?
Most students prep 4–8 weeks per exam. The CLEP® itself is 90 minutes. Credit typically posts to your transcript 2–4 weeks after transmission.
